Heritage® is a broad-spectrum fungicide which can be used to tackle a range of key turf diseases.
The active substance, azoxystrobin, works by blocking the pathogens’ ability to produce energy. Heritage® is a systemic fungicide with acropetal (upwards) movement through the plant. This means that it is most effective when used preventatively when conditions are suitable for disease development, but symptoms have not yet been observed.
Heritage® can be absorbed through the roots, crown, shoots, and leaves, and is then evenly distributed and actively recycled through the plant. Heritage® gives long-lasting protection against turf diseases.

Diseases targeted:
Anthracnose
Brown Patch
Fairy rings (type 2)
Microdochium
Rust
Take-all patch
Summary
Contains | 500g/kg azoxystrobin |
Application rate | 0.5kg/ha |
Water rate | 125-1,000l/ha |
Max treatments per year | 4 |
Crops | Managed amenity turf |
Application equipment | Vehicle mounted boom sprayer Kanpsack sprayer |
Mode of action | Respiration |
FRAC group | 11 |
Application category | Protective: local penetrant Curative: acropetal penetrant |
